According to ASSOCHAM president, Dr. Niranjan Hiranandani, core sectors like coal and mining of minerals and aviation has been given an overhauling for effectiveness. By liberalizing entry norms for private players in the mining of coal and minerals, the country has opened a level playing field which will, in turn, increase the productivity of these sectors. This will attract major investments in these sectors and make India as a business-friendly destination. He explained that the Indian aviation sector would also save crores of rupees in maintenance due to the government’s efforts to make it into a Maintenance, Repair, and Overhaul (MRO) hub. These airlines had to fly to other countries earlier to repair its faulty aircraft.
